Embodiment 1

[0051] In this embodiment, the high-yield Roman pink-shell hens are used as a material to cultivate modern high-yield layer hens as an example:

[0052]Establish standard DNA fingerprints of high-yield Roman pink-shell layer A, B, C, D pure lines; construct DNA fingerprints of newly introduced grandparent chickens every year, and compare them, and select A, B, C, D pure line.

[0053] 1. High-yielding laying hen A' matching line is bred by the following method, and the specific operation steps are:

[0054] (1) Use the imported rooster of the high-yield Roman powder ancestor A line that meets the standard map and the introduced hen that meets the standard map high-yield Roman powder ancestor B line to cross to obtain the F1 generation

[0055] (2) Keep the F1 generation for breeding The F2 generation was obtained by crossing a hen with a newly introduced rooster that conformed to the A line of the Roman Fen progenitor of the standard map

Abstract

The invention discloses a new strain of modern high-yielding laying hens, a breeding method and application thereof, and belongs to the technical field of poultry seed production. In the present invention, the introduced high-yielding grandparent cock and hen are hybridized to obtain two-line matching parents, and then mated with the newly introduced grandparent cock or hen respectively, and this process is repeated until each laying hen strain contains Correspondingly, 99.22% blood relationship of the introduced ancestors is equivalent to the imported high-yielding breed. Based on this new strain, a family line is established, and a high-yielding laying hen matching line is obtained after systematic selection. The invention makes full use of the existing excellent genetic resources of high-yield laying hens, greatly shortens the breeding period, reduces cumbersome operation steps such as combining ability determination, and improves breeding efficiency. At the same time, the external blood can be opened according to the latest research results of international mainstream high-yield laying hen breeds to further improve its production performance, speed up the cultivation of high-production performance laying hen breeds in my country, and improve the core competitiveness of my country's laying hen seed industry.
